WebJan 1, 2013 · The genus Chromis (Pisces: Pomacentridae) is represented by seven species in the eastern Pacific, two slender-bodied species (C. atrilobata and C. punctipinnis) and five deep-bodied species. WebOct 2, 2006 · Thalassoma lucasanum and Chromis atrilobata were the dominant species (62.5% of total abundance, and occurrence of 97% and 72%, respectively). Conversely, 50 species had low relative abundance, <1% of total abundance, and a frequency of occurrence <50% of the census. None of the ecological descriptors were significantly …
